Output 28863a43bf8001734cba663de4e1a7d1e45ca8eb4e1e653ffd62ead03cfa3777:2
- value
- 34091994
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 391dfacdb87af2cc4f22d7a83bb2a89b2e732138 OP_EQUAL
- address
- MD7AfPcaa9gVeF296NRAzZUJ8YH1CcJJ6o
- transaction
- 28863a43bf8001734cba663de4e1a7d1e45ca8eb4e1e653ffd62ead03cfa3777
- spent
- true